Notes:

1). Prep:  During prep time (20 minutes for JV and Varsity; 30 for Novice), debaters may use the internet, take notes by hand, and use paper notes during the debate (no computer access during debate, though phones can be used as timers).  Although JV and Varsity debaters may NOT receive real-time assistance with their arguments from persons other than their partner, Novices may consult with teammates or other debaters at the tournament.  Coach prep is NOT allowed for any division.   

2) Debaters:  “Prep” times reflect when debaters should be present in the prep area and ready to go, NOT when the resolution is released.  They should go to their round room at the listed start time; forfeit is ten minutes later.  Ex.  For Novice Round 1, novices should be in prep room at 8:20 when pairings will be blasted, topic is read at 8:25, debaters be in room at 9:00, forfeit at 9:10 if no show.    

3) Judges:  Please be in your assigned room five minutes before the round.  ONLY press the round START time on your Tabroom e-ballot once both teams are there.  (Those without ballots should use this time to grab refreshments, check their devices, and finish prior round comments.)

4) Protests:  All protests should be brought immediately to the attention of event director Vy Linh Nguyen in the Parli Tab Room. All wishing to protest must bring an adult, ideally the coach. The burden of proof  is on the protesting team/coach; they need to supply evidence and the rule broken. Rules/norms from outside organizations will not be considered valid. No team is required to follow any rule that isn't a GGSA rule. 

5)  Don't be alarmed if you come to your assigned room, and there is another debate, usually it's in the process of wrapping up.  Just wait until it is done.  Note that each round is double flighted, meaning each round alternates between one Novice debate and one JV/V debate.

6)  All times are approximate.  Whenever possible, we will move rounds up in order to expedite the tournament.  Sometimes delays occur—please remember that our volunteer-run organization does its best!
